Promotion of life skills through routines that enhance independence involves creating structured daily routines that allow students to practice and develop essential life skills such as time management, organization, and self-care. These routines provide students with opportunities to learn and practice these skills in a supportive and structured environment, ultimately leading to increased independence and self-sufficiency.

Teacher-directed routines, on the other hand, involve teachers guiding and directing students through specific tasks and activities to help them develop and strengthen their life skills. Teachers play a crucial role in modeling and teaching these skills, providing guidance and support as students navigate through various routines and tasks.

By incorporating both student-directed and teacher-directed routines into the classroom, educators can effectively promote the development of life skills and independence in students, ultimately preparing them for success in school and beyond.

Promotion of Life Skills through Routines

Life skills are essential abilities that enable individuals to live independently and successfully. Routines play a crucial role in promoting life skills by providing structure, predictability, and opportunities for practice.

Teacher-Directed Routines

- Establish clear routines for daily activities, such as mealtimes, transitions, and bedtime.
- Gradually encourage students to participate in these routines, assigning them small tasks.
- Provide visual cues and verbal prompts to support students' understanding and independence.

Routines that Enhance Independence

- Encourage self-care routines, such as dressing, grooming, and toileting, through guided practice.
- Provide opportunities for students to make choices within routines, such as selecting their breakfast cereal or deciding on an activity.
- Gradually reduce teacher assistance as students gain proficiency, promoting self-reliance.

Benefits of Routine-Based Life Skills Promotion

- Improved independence and self-care abilities
- Enhanced confidence and self-esteem
- Development of problem-solving and decision-making skills
- Reduced anxiety and stress
- Increased social participation and interaction

Example

- A morning routine can include students helping to set the breakfast table, making their beds, and packing their backpacks. By gradually assigning more tasks, teachers promote independence and the development of life skills in these areas.
